2.
Do not advertise any private DNS server here.
Do not advertise any privately hosted DNS server here. The /r/pihole community cannot vet, and therefore does not want to appear to vouch for, public DNS servers hosted by individuals.

7.
No Dashboard Screenshot posts
We get it, you're impressed with the numbers on your dashboard! We're glad to see that Pi-hole is performing well for you, but nearly every one of them is identical, and it clutters up the sub.
This rule does not apply IF
- The screenshot is to discuss a bug that has not already been posted about/reported on Github.
- The screenshot is part of a more detailed post, describing a very specific situation in which a screenshot of the dashboard is absolutely necessary
